Understanding the Basics of Truck Air Transportation
Truck air transportation combines the flexibility of road transport with the speed of air freight. It involves the use of trucks to transport goods to and from airports, where they are then loaded onto aircraft for long - distance delivery. This hybrid approach allows for door - to - door service, making it an attractive option for a wide range of industries, from manufacturing to e - commerce.
Size Restrictions
Size restrictions in truck air transportation are primarily determined by two factors: the capabilities of the trucks used for ground transport and the specifications of the aircraft.
Truck - Related Size Constraints
Trucks come in various sizes, each with its own maximum cargo capacity in terms of volume. Standard trucks used in freight transportation typically have a maximum length of around 48 - 53 feet, a width of 8.5 feet, and a height of 13.5 feet. These dimensions limit the size of individual items or the overall volume of goods that can be loaded onto a single truck.
For oversized cargo, special permits may be required, and the transportation process becomes more complex. Oversized items may need to be transported on flatbed trucks or specialized trailers, which can accommodate larger dimensions but may also face additional restrictions, such as lower speed limits and specific routes.
Aircraft - Related Size Constraints
Once the goods reach the airport, they must fit into the cargo holds of the aircraft. Different types of aircraft have different cargo hold dimensions. For example, narrow - body aircraft like the Boeing 737 have relatively limited cargo space, with a maximum width of around 2.4 meters and a height of 1.6 meters. Wide - body aircraft, such as the Boeing 747 or Airbus A380, offer much larger cargo holds, with widths of up to 6 meters and heights of several meters.
Cargo must also be properly packed and configured to fit within the available space. Irregularly shaped items may need to be repackaged or disassembled to ensure they can be loaded safely and efficiently.
Weight Restrictions
Weight restrictions are equally important in truck air transportation, as exceeding the weight limits can pose safety risks and lead to regulatory issues.
Truck Weight Restrictions
Truck weight limits are set by government regulations to ensure road safety. In the United States, for example, the maximum gross vehicle weight (GVW), which includes the weight of the truck, trailer, and cargo, is typically around 80,000 pounds. This weight limit is distributed across the axles of the truck and trailer to prevent excessive wear on the roads and reduce the risk of accidents.
The weight of the cargo itself is also a crucial factor. Overloading a truck can cause mechanical problems, such as brake failure and tire blowouts, and can result in hefty fines for the transportation company.
Aircraft Weight Restrictions
Aircraft have strict weight limitations based on their design and performance capabilities. The maximum take - off weight (MTOW) of an aircraft includes the weight of the aircraft itself, fuel, crew, passengers (if applicable), and cargo. Airlines carefully calculate the weight distribution of the cargo to ensure the aircraft remains balanced during flight.
Exceeding the weight limits of an aircraft can lead to reduced fuel efficiency, longer take - off and landing distances, and potential safety hazards. Airlines may also charge additional fees for overweight cargo.
Impact of Size and Weight Restrictions on Truck Air Transportation
The size and weight restrictions in truck air transportation have a significant impact on the logistics process.
Cost
Oversized or overweight cargo often incurs additional costs. Special permits for oversized cargo, specialized equipment for handling large items, and extra fees for overweight cargo on aircraft can all add to the overall transportation cost. As a result, businesses need to carefully consider the size and weight of their goods when planning their logistics strategy.


Transit Time
Transporting oversized or overweight cargo may also result in longer transit times. Obtaining special permits can take time, and the transportation of large items may require more careful planning and coordination. At the airport, loading and unloading oversized cargo may take longer, which can delay the departure of the aircraft.
Availability of Carriers
Not all carriers are equipped to handle oversized or overweight cargo. Finding a carrier that can accommodate large or heavy items may be more challenging, especially in regions with limited infrastructure or strict regulations.
